:&#039;&#039;&amp;quot;We are purposely NOT tying features to fundraising goals because we do not want to be tied to anything beyond what we original promised and we want room to add features we weren&#039;t planning on (Jumping is the poster child for this). If we tied fundraising goals to specific features then we would remove the ability to react to feedback during testing.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;We do however understand the power of fundraising goals and so our current strategy is to periodically set fun goals that will not cost the project any funds. That lets us keep the funds focused on promised features with some room to spend on emergent features (jumping). We also want the community to help us set these goals...&amp;quot;&#039;&#039;&lt;br /&gt;
::-&#039;&#039;&#039;[[DarkStarr]]&#039;&#039;&#039;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Pledge Drives==&lt;br /&gt;
----&lt;br /&gt;
=== Kickstarter Goals ===&lt;br /&gt;
{{Infobox&lt;br /&gt;
|name=Kickstarter Rewards&lt;br /&gt;
|image=Kickstarter-stretch-goals-original.jpg&lt;br /&gt;
}}&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.1 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Pet System!&lt;br /&gt;
*One word... [[:Category:Pets|pets]]! Both social and combat pets will be added to the game, which players can control using simple commands&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.2 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Seasonal Weather!&lt;br /&gt;
*Grab your cloak! We&#039;re adding game-changing weather to the game.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.3 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Interactive Music Instruments!&lt;br /&gt;
*Unleash your inner Bard! We will be adding interactive pianos, harps, lutes, flutes, and drums!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.4 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Taming!&lt;br /&gt;
*We will expand our pet system to allow the player to tame certain Monsters to act as pets.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.5 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Content is King + Iolo + Spoony Interviews&lt;br /&gt;
*[[Denis Loubet]] cover art!&lt;br /&gt;
*New [[David Watson|David &amp;quot;Iolo&amp;quot; Watson]] [[Karelia&#039;s Song|musical composition]].&lt;br /&gt;
*Noah &amp;quot;Spoony&amp;quot; Antwiler [[Britannia Burns|interviews (roasts?)]] Richard &amp;quot;Lord British&amp;quot; Garriott.&lt;br /&gt;
*20 additional unique scenes including arctic scene sets.&lt;br /&gt;
*Starting continent doubles in size.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.6 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Shipping Lanes Open for Business + New Island Content Set + Soundtrack&lt;br /&gt;
*New &amp;quot;Mysterious Island&#039; content, city, and scenes.&lt;br /&gt;
*Ports with boats that run on schedules to transport players to areas beyond the mainland; Safety not guaranteed!&lt;br /&gt;
*Trans-Atlantic shipping lanes open the way for localization to other languages.&lt;br /&gt;
:*The first language announced was German, along with the [[Edelmann (Benefactor)|Edelmann]] pledge tier.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.7 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Dynamic and Contests Resource Nodes + Optional Minimap System&lt;br /&gt;
*Meteorites, volcanic eruptions, outbreaks of rare plants and animals can appear and vanish suddenly for those who are paying attention. Some PvP focused resources appear in tile.&lt;br /&gt;
*Optional minimap system for the directionally impaired!&lt;br /&gt;
*The Lost Vale - A new mini-adventure centered around a lost valley previously hidden to players, now visible only during special astronomical alignments.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.8 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Tracy Hickman Novel + Catacombs + Apprentice System + Cloaks&lt;br /&gt;
*[Blade of the Avatar|Serialized novel] by [[Tracy Hickman]] as a prequel to the SotA storyline, distributed in digital form for all pledge tiers, and printed version for higher pledges.&lt;br /&gt;
*Massive, interconnected underworld with a story and ecology all its own.&lt;br /&gt;
*Apprentice system allows players with &amp;quot;Master&amp;quot; level skills to help lower skill players advance more quickly.&lt;br /&gt;
*Cloaks with full cloth simulation including being affected by wind.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$1.9 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: The World is a Stage&lt;br /&gt;
*A new City Center Theater Building.&lt;br /&gt;
*Rentable by an individual or group for a performance.&lt;br /&gt;
*Only approved individuals may enter backstage or on stage.&lt;br /&gt;
*Players must pay to enter seating areas.&lt;br /&gt;
*Viewers may only emote, such as claps. (Claps are tracked to &amp;quot;rate&amp;quot; the performance)&lt;br /&gt;
*Money goes to performers for their performance.&lt;br /&gt;
*Also usable for weddings and other community events!&lt;br /&gt;
*We add a full complement of &amp;quot;masks&amp;quot; and &amp;quot;costumes&amp;quot; for use at various events.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$2 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Players Take Over the World&lt;br /&gt;
*Castles &amp;amp; Keeps effectively a new &amp;quot;Town Type&amp;quot;, where the structure is ownable by players or guilds.&lt;br /&gt;
*Guilds can declare war against other guilds.&lt;br /&gt;
*Guilds can declare as full time PVP.&lt;br /&gt;
*Guilds can earn a guild house and guild bank.&lt;br /&gt;
*Guild tabbard/shield/flags usable by all members.&lt;br /&gt;
*Minimum of 5 castle types added to the game.&lt;br /&gt;
*Castle merchants with unique merchandise.&lt;br /&gt;
*Castle defense scenarios for most castles which can be played offline as well as online.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$2.25 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Mod Tools + Unique Art Creation Skill + Expanded Player Customization &amp;lt;font style=&amp;quot;color:red&amp;quot;&amp;gt;(unmet)&amp;lt;/font&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
*Work begins to expose options for player modification of the offline game and limited elements of the online game.&lt;br /&gt;
*Skill for &amp;quot;Art Creation&amp;quot; to create actual individual unique art to show and trade in game.&lt;br /&gt;
*&amp;quot;New You&amp;quot; detailed character creator - We will provide tools well beyond the basic choices of gender, body/face/hair types, and layer in morph targets to customize your avatar to be &amp;quot;the real you&amp;quot; at the in-game &amp;quot;New You&amp;quot; salons.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&#039;&#039;&#039;$2.5 Million&#039;&#039;&#039;: Full VR Treatment &amp;lt;font style=&amp;quot;color:red&amp;quot;&amp;gt;(unmet)&amp;lt;/font&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
*Virtual Reality: We will support the all the great new VR technologies that are coming of age now. Key example is the Occulus Rift HMD goggles.&am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&amp;amp;nbsp;&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;div&gt;__NOTOC__== Ownership 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
There are four ways to purchase a [[Property Deed]]. [[Backer]]s at [[Ancestor (Benefactor)]] and above receive a Rent-Free Property Deed with their pledge. Players can also purchase a Property Deed from other players. Players can buy tickets for the monthly lotteries for player-owned-town-only and place-anywhere deeds.  Finally, players can purchase limited amounts of player-owned-town-only deeds from the [[Add-On Store]]&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;https://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?page_id=19#faq_53&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;.  Players are allowed to own multiple lots&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;https://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?page_id=19#faq_52&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Sizes 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Lots come in six sizes: [[Row lot|Row]] (smallest), [[Village lot|Village]], [[Town lot|Town]], [[City lot|City]],  [[Keep lot|Keep]]  and [[Castle lot|Castle]] (largest). Each Holdfast, Village, Town, City, or Metropolis in the game will have a mix of lot sizes available. The larger the habitation, the larger the number of lots and the greater percentage of bigger lots available. For example, a Metropolis will have the greatest number of lots and the highest percentage of City-sized lots&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;https://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?page_id=19#faq_54&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Upkeep 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Lots have an in-game currency tax that must be paid or the lot reverts to being for sale and the Property Deed is returned to the owner. [[Backer]]s at Ancestor level and above receive a tax-exempt Property Deed, but the lot can still revert after an extended amount of inactivity (5 months at Citizen level, + one month per tier above that)&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;https://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?page_id=19#faq_55&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The upkeep rates are:&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?p=61019 Property Tax Rates]&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Row: 500 gold per day, 1 Gold COTO per week &am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Village: 1000 gold per day, 2 Gold COTOs per week &am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Town: 2000 gold per day, 4 Gold COTOs per week &am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
City: 3500 gold per day, 7 Gold COTOs per week &am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Reverting 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Your [[Housing|house]] (and the contents) will be placed in your bank. Decorations will not be maintained when you place the house again on a lot.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;https://www.shroudoftheavatar.com/?page_id=19#faq_56&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;.  This can be avoided by storing the house using the [[Property Manager]] before the lot reverts.&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;div&gt;[[Crafting Stations]] are used in the [[Crafting Stations#Refining Stations|Refining]] and [[Crafting Stations#Production Stations|Production]] stages of item creation, and require training in the appropriate [[Craft Sigil|Crafting skill]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Refining Stations==&lt;br /&gt;
Refining stations are used to turn gathered resources into usable materials. Although the direct skills are listed below, note that some items created can be useful in multiple production skills.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Butchering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
Using your [[Butchery]] skill, you can turn raw cuts of meat (gathered with [[Field Dressing]]) into chops for [[Cooking]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Milling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Forestry|Gathered wood]] can be shaped in boards and timber, useful for [[Carpentry]] work, using your [[Milling]] skill.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Smelting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
Raw ore from [[Mining]] can be processed using [[Smelting]] into shapes suitable for [[Blacksmithing]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Tanning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Tanning]] allows you to turn [[Field Dressing|Field Dressed]] hides into leathers and skins, more suited for [[Tailoring]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Textiles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Textiles]] transforms raw [[Agriculture]] crops into [[Tailoring]] usable forms, such as cloth and thread.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Production Stations==&lt;br /&gt;
Production stations are used to turn refined materials into their end product. Although the most direct linked skills are listed, recipes often require ingredients from multiple disciplines.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Alchemy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Alchemy]] uses [[Foraging|Foraged]] reagents to create specialized goods.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Blacksmithing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
Skilled [[Blacksmithing|Blacksmiths]] can turn [[Smelting|Smelted]] metal into a wide variety of tools, weapons and armor.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Carpentry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Carpentry|Carpenters]] use [[Milling|Milled]] lumber to craft structures, tools, and weapons.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Cooking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
The art of [[Cooking]] allows a player to take [[Agriculture|Crops]], [[Butchery|Meat]] and even [[Foraging|Wild Forage]] and turn it into fine food or drink.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Tailoring Station]]===&lt;br /&gt;
Using [[Tanning|Tanned]] skin and hides or [[Textiles]], a [[Tailoring|Tailor]] can sew clothes, armor, taming collars, and decorations.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Other Stations==&lt;br /&gt;
These stations are used for miscellaneous crafting.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Planter Box]]===&lt;br /&gt;
Using your [[Agriculture]] skill, you can grow plants.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Printing Press]]===&lt;br /&gt;
You can craft books and scrolls, or make copies of existing books and scrolls.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Obsidian Forge]]===&lt;br /&gt;
You can craft armor and weapons out of obsidian.&lt;br /&gt;
